Increase of the Tax Advantages for People “Incoming” to Italy
Maurizio Bottoni from Interconsulting Studio Associato on
With the Law Decree n. 34 dated April 30, 2019, the Italian Government has just modified the tax special regimes provided in favor of researchers and lecturers (see my previous article of 2017) and other “incoming” people who decide to move to Italy. The above mentioned tax regimes are granted in order to encourage the scientific and technological development in Italy and “incoming” of human capital and provide important tax exemption from IRPEF (Italian personal income tax) and IRAP (Italian regional income tax) purposes.
